Of the 296 sales on record, 287 were bought off-plan from the developer and 9 were resales of a finished home. The changeover in 2026 is the handover. The 2026 bar is part-year.

Where these numbers come from. Every figure on this page is drawn from the Dubai Land Department’s transaction register, read directly from the Dubai Data Exchange. It is what buyers actually paid, recorded at transfer — not asking prices, not valuations, not our own estimates. Mortgage registrations, gift transfers, rent-to-own contracts and developers’ own filings are all excluded; none of them is a price a buyer paid. Medians are used rather than averages so one unusual sale cannot move the number. Data through 2 Sept 2026.
